The word “latte” comes from the Italian word “caffè e latte” (other variants are “caffeelatte” and “caffellatte”), which simply means “coffee & milk. Café Au Lait Another translation of "coffee with milk," au lait on the average American coffee-shop menu typically means brewed coffee with steamed milk, as opposed to espresso with steamed milk (see above: Café Latte).
